ENIAC
- The Triumphs and Tragedies of the World's First Computer
- By: Scott McCartney
- Narrated by: Adams Morgan
- Length: 6 hrs and 18 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all535
-
Performance314
-
Story323
The world's first programmable computer was the legendary ENIAC (Electronic Numerical Integrator and Computer), built by John Mauchly and Presper Eckert. Based on original interviews with surviving participants and the first study of Mauchly and Eckert's personal papers, ENIAC is a dramatic human story and a vital contribution to the history of technology, and it restores to the two inventors the legacy they deserve.
